Skip to main content
POST
/
external
/
datastores
/
update
/
{id}
Actualiza un documento existente en un datastore
curl --request POST \
  --url https://app.braviloai.com/api/external/datastores/update/{id} \
  --header 'Authorization: Bearer <token>' \
  --header 'Content-Type: application/json' \
  --data '
{
  "id": "<string>",
  "text": "<string>",
  "name": "<string>",
  "metadata": {}
}
'
{
  "id": "<string>"
}
Actualiza el texto y metadatos de un documento ya existente. El documento se re-procesa para actualizar los embeddings.
Si el datastore es público, no se requiere token de autorización.

Ejemplo

curl -X POST https://app.braviloai.com/api/external/datastores/update/${datastoreId} \
-H "Authorization: Bearer ${API_KEY}" \
-H "Content-Type: application/json" \
-d '{
"id": "doc_001",
"name": "Política v2",
"text": "Nuevo contenido actualizado...",
"metadata": { "version": "2.0" }
}'

Authorizations

Authorization
string
header
required

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

Path Parameters

id
string
required

ID del datastore

Body

application/json
id
string
required

ID del documento a actualizar

text
string
required
name
string
metadata
object

Response

Documento actualizado y re-procesado

id
string